Definition of ARCHEOLOGY

noun

Uncommon spelling of archaeology.

Wiktionary · CC BY-SA

Where it comes from

From Middle French archéologie, from Ancient Greek ἀρχαιολογία (arkhaiología, “antiquarian lore, ancient legends, history”), from ἀρχαῖος (arkhaîos, “primal, old, ancient”) + λόγος (lógos, “speech, oration, study”). By surface analysis, archeo- + -logy, but not coined in that way.
